What are some interesting web scraping projects 1

What Are The Most Interesting Web Scraping Projects You Have Done?

What are some interesting web scraping projects?

This is a beginner-level project that is great for honing your JavaScript skills. In this project, you’ll design a website’s login authentication bar – the place users enter their e-mail ID/username and password to log in to the location. Since almost each web site now comes with a login authentication feature, learning this skill will come in useful in your future web projects and functions. Author Bio

About the Author: Avah is a blogger at cbdtherapy, weedworldmagazine.org and dankgeekcbd.








Address: 928 Canada CourtCity of Industry, California

Published Articles:

Guest post

As Featured in

http://mirror.co.uk/FMiner is one other popular software for web scraping, data extraction, crawling screen scraping, macro, and web assist for Window and Mac OS. Diffbot permits you to get numerous kind of useful data from the web with out the hassle.

Use the net scraping tutorials to tug back an preliminary information set and build issues up from there. If you discover one thing attention-grabbing that the rest of the community could like, drop us a observe in the comments section below. However, in case your web scraping needs are something extra in depth than a once-off simple information extraction task, then you should significantly consider using the Scrapy framework. Scrapy has been designed as the entire solution for internet scraping , so it’s the most suitable choice if you wish to construct a robust and flexible internet crawler.

Neither is data mining reserved for big know-how firms with highly effective computing power, massive budgets, and analysis teams. Apify is an fascinating web scraping platform for coders. If you’ve fundamental coding abilities you may need to give a try. Instead, you need to write JavaScript to inform the crawler what you wish to extract. Content Grabber is a robust multi-featured visible web scraping tool used for content extraction from the online.

There are efforts using machine learning and pc imaginative and prescient that try to establish and extract info from internet pages by deciphering pages visually as a human being might. A easy yet powerful method to extract information from net pages can be based mostly on the UNIX grep command or regular expression-matching amenities of programming languages .
Scrapy additionally makes it very easy to extend through the development of custom middlewares or pipelines to your internet scraping projects which may give you the specific functionality you require. In contrast, when a spider constructed utilizing Selenium visits a web page, it’s going to first execute all the JavaScript out there on the web page before making it available for the parser to parse the information. The benefit of this method is that it lets you scrape information not obtainable without JS or a full browser. However, the online scraping course of is far slower in comparison with a simple HTTP request to the web browser as a result of the spider will execute all the scripts current on the net page.

Scrape A Leads Database For Someone Else (Or Sell It!)

This is why most businesses use the best web scraping services to make the follow manageable and handy. The greatest web scraping instruments use high-quality rotational swimming pools of residential proxy servers to avoid detection when scraping. Retailers, due to this fact, carry out Amazon data scraping as a result of it’s convenient and saves a lot of time, which would have been spent looking for information from disparate web sites. Large businesses scrape the web for helpful knowledge and reap great benefits from it. Web scraping is nevertheless not a protect of huge companies alone.
It can automatically gather full content constructions such as product catalogs or search results. For individuals with great programming abilities can find a more practical means by way of Visual Studio 2013 built-in into Content Grabber. Content Grabber offers extra options for customers with many third-celebration instruments.
The historic judgment made it clear that any public information devoid of any copyright safety is truthful sport to web scrapers. The only limitation there appears to be with net scraped information is within the commercial utilization of the data mined. In the past, the regulation on scraping has been ambiguous and there are cases the place a enterprise has sued the opposite over the follow.
You may use internet-scraping for this or obtain information through an API from an internet site or content material provider. The empireonline film review web site contained 475 pages with 24 movie links per page making a total of apporximately motion pictures. The film score, critiques and the other variables could be scraped by navigating to the individual movie web page.
If you need to discover the best web scraper in your project, make sure to learn on. Web scraping refers to the extraction of knowledge from an internet site.
We have other blog posts that will answer all of your questions! The most typical problem for net scraping is tips on how to get round web web page blocks when scraping large e-commerce sites. Also, when you have net scraping project ideas, you must learn more about data gathering methods for e-commerce. So, you’re planning a project on net scraping and don’t know the place to start? Or perhaps you’re looking for a solution greatest suited for your web scraping projects?
One of the massive advantages of utilizing BeautifulSoup is its simplicity and ability to automate some of the recurring elements of parsing data during net scraping. Requestsis a python library designed to simplify the method of making HTTP requests. This is highly priceless for web scraping because step one in any internet scraping workflow is to ship an HTTP request to the web site’s server to retrieve the information displayed on the goal net web page.
Automated net scrapers work in a rather simple but in addition advanced means. After all, web sites are built for humans to grasp, not machines.
Whatever your case is, we may help you out here a little bit. However, every single project on this record could be completed utilizing ParseHub, a powerful and free web scraper. However, you would possibly still be wondering what net scraper you ought to be using to carry out your project. The truth is that the most effective net scraper for your project might be totally different depending on the needs of your project. First, you’d should ask them in regards to the particulars of their enterprise and what kind of leads they might discover valuable.
This info is collected and then exported right into a format that is more useful for the person. Inspect component of an online pageThen, locate the data you wish to scrape and click on it. The highlighted half in the inspector pane exhibits the underlying HTML text of the webpage part of curiosity. The CSS class of the factor is what Beautifulsoup will use to extract the information from the html.
After the info is extracted it may be easily represented in the type of an utility or stored in a database for any sort of analysis on it. In this project, you will learn to scrape a web site by Scrappy and storing it in a database made with MongoDB. Apart from learning the coursework, it’s actually necessary for any scholar to work on projects. Hand – on experience by doing sixteen actual life internet scraping tasks. The more you understand about your scraping wants, the better of an thought you will have about what’s the best net scraper for you.
The web site construct-up upfront seemed perfect for scraping with scrapy shell however for some unexplained reason, the web site couldn’t be accessed used scrapy shell . Scraping using selenium needed to be utilized and this turned out to be an exercise on patience.
80legs is a powerful internet crawling tool that can be configured primarily based on customized necessities. It is interesting that you could customise your app to scrape and crawl, but if you are not a tech person, you need to be cautious.

Datacenter Proxies

Most websites simply put measures in place to manage knowledge scraping by blocking, banning or flagging IP addresses of data mining bots. Mining for information on web sites isn’t with out its complications.
The scope of this knowledge additionally increases with the number of options you’d like your scraper to have. Most internet scrapers will output information to a CSV or Excel spreadsheet, whereas extra advanced scrapers will help other formats such as JSON which can be used for an API. Lastly, the web scraper will output all the information that has been collected right into a format that is more helpful to the consumer.
What are some interesting web scraping projects?
You need not pay the expense of costly net scraping or doing handbook analysis. The tool will enable you to exact structured data from any URL with AI extractors. Bypass CAPTCHA points rotating proxies to extract actual-time knowledge with ease.
  • While surfing on the internet, many websites don’t allow the consumer to save information for personal use.
  • If you need proxies for, let’s say, a web scraping project like market analysis – datacenter proxies might be more than sufficient for you.
  • One method is to manually copy-paste the information, which each tedious and time-consuming.
  • These proxies are quick, secure, and most of all – lots cheaper than residential proxies.
  • why simple text newsletters work , our staff of seasoned scraping veterans develops a scraper distinctive to your project, designed particularly to focus on and extract the info you want from the websites you need it from.

If companies wish to understand the general sentiment for his or her products amongst their customers, then Sentiment Analysis is a should. Companies can use web scraping to collect knowledge from social media websites such as Facebook and Twitter as to what the overall sentiment about their merchandise is. This will assist them in creating products that people need and shifting ahead of their competitors. Web scraping can be utilized for market research by companies.

The CNIL pointers made it clear that publicly out there information is still personal data and cannot be repurposed with out the information of the individual to whom that data belongs. QVC’s complaint alleges that the defendant disguised its web crawler to mask its source IP handle and thus prevented QVC from rapidly repairing the issue. This is a particularly interesting scraping case as a result of QVC is seeking damages for the unavailability of their website, which QVC claims was attributable to Resultly. One of the primary main checks of display scraping concerned American Airlines , and a firm called FareChase.
Make sure you understand what you are doing on each step when you customize your scrape. 80legs helps fetching huge quantities of knowledge along with the choice to download the extracted knowledge immediately. And It could be very nice that you could crawl as much as URLs per run within the free plan. Web Scrapping performs a vital position in extracting information from social media web sites similar to Twitter, Facebook, and Instagram, to search out the trending topics. In this article onWeb Scraping with Python, you will find out about internet scraping in brief and see how to extract knowledge from an internet site with an indication.
Your host as ordinary is Tobias Macey and today I’m interviewing Attila Tóth about doing knowledge extraction with web scraping. We will level you in the direction of an attention-grabbing data supply, accessible via net scraping, and you may build things up from there.
The scraping process was plagued with numerous computer freeze-out, restarts and inconsistent knowledge being written to disk with the 6 GB laptop working at almost a hundred % cpu utilization. The freeze-outs and corrupt information was diminished by firing get requests for less software end user licence agreement than 250 urls at a time which took between 40 and 70 minutes to be completed. Fortunately scraping from my was not blocked but the website seem to be implementing some throttling mechanisms which increased the scraping time the extra i scraped.
This means that in case your net scraper has a excessive usage of CPU or RAM, your computer might become fairly sluggish whereas your scrape runs. With lengthy scraping duties, this might put your laptop out of fee for hours. On the opposite hand, some web scrapers will have a full-fledged UI the place the web site is absolutely rendered for the user to only click on on the info they want to scrape. These net scrapers are usually easier to work with for most individuals with limited technical data. However, the tools out there to construct your own net scraper nonetheless require some superior programming information.

By Data Driven Investor

High-quality web scraped information obtained in giant volumes can be very helpful for corporations in analyzing consumer tendencies and understand which direction the corporate ought to move in the future. You can have Self-constructed Web Scrapers however that requires superior information of programming. And if you want more features in your Web Scraper, then you definitely need much more knowledge. On the other hand, Pre-constructed Web Scrapers are previously created scrapers you could download and run simply. These also have more advanced choices that you could customise.

After this, you can setup your internet scraper to scrape leads data from the internet to build your database. Before we get began, you may be wondering what net scraping is in the first place. In short, web scraping refers to the extraction of information from an internet site on to a more useful format. On April 30, 2020, French Data Protection Authority released new pointers on internet scraping.
Do not scrape knowledge at such excessive speeds and consistency that you simply convey hurt to the server hosting the website that you are scraping. Such activities will make the location unavailable to its common customers or completely slow down the loading occasions of its pages, making it unusable as nicely.
AA efficiently obtained an injunction from a Texas trial court, stopping FareChase from selling software that enables users to check on-line fares if the software program additionally searches AA’s website. The airline argued that FareChase’s websearch software trespassed on AA’s servers when it collected the publicly obtainable knowledge. By June, FareChase and AA agreed to settle and the enchantment was dropped.
Additionally, in case your scraper is set to run on numerous URLs , it could possibly have an impact on your ISP’s knowledge 11 reasons why your emails go to spam caps. Local internet scrapers will run on your pc using its assets and internet connection.

Planning A Web Scraping Project? Here Is What You Need To Know

Our shopper wants data feed about magnificence merchandise offered at multiple major online retailers. Data from all sources is normalised into single schema and delivered to consumer in CSV format. Kickstarter datasets embody all current and historic projects on Kickstarter. Being new to the Python programming, here are a number of the initiatives you can develop in Python. In this project, one learns Scrape Top 50 Movies on IMDb.
The best known of those instances, eBay v. Bidder’s Edge, resulted in an injunction ordering Bidder’s Edge to cease accessing, collecting, and indexing auctions from the eBay web site. This case concerned automatic inserting of bids, known as auction sniping. Not all circumstances of net spidering brought before the courts have been thought of trespass to chattels.

Web Scraping With Python

What are some interesting web scraping projects?
Ultimately, the flexibleness and scalability of web scraping ensures your project parameters, irrespective of how particular, can be met with ease. More than a modern convenience, the true power of internet scraping lies in its ability to build and power a few of the world’s most revolutionary enterprise functions. ‘Transformative’ doesn’t even start to explain the best way some corporations use web scraped information to boost their operations, informing executive choices all the way in which right down to particular person customer service experiences. Web scraping, also referred to as internet information extraction, is the process of retrieving or “scraping” knowledge from an internet site.
However, that did not cease us from writing our information on what makes the Best Web Scraper. Cloud-based mostly net scrapers run on an off-site server which is normally offered by the company who developed the scraper itself. This implies that your laptop’s resources are freed up while your scraper runs and gathers information. You can then work on different tasks and be notified later as soon as your scrape is ready to be exported.

The web sites chosen by the rest of the cohort ranged from e-commerce to information web sites displaying the completely different purposes of web scraping. Our net scraping project was part of the Data Science fellows program at ITC which was designed to show us to the true world problems a data scientist faces as well as to improve our coding abilities. By understanding how e-commerce websites protect themselves, net blocks may be avoided. There are very specific practices that may allow you to scrape data off e-commerce web sites without getting banned.

About the Author